Output 8bfa05ed0685a18d858e47d0342fd79eb8ade5b01f64037a4837665f77582d0a:80

value
51639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127d3580eb5e07fbedb1812b10da6b425f8266cc OP_EQUAL
address
33Nn5fqZpD536VvH6G1LpzAUduf2AifPKi
transaction
8bfa05ed0685a18d858e47d0342fd79eb8ade5b01f64037a4837665f77582d0a
spent
true